An optical path offsetter is an optical device used to shift a light beam a certain distance along an axis perpendicular to its propagation direction without altering its propagation direction. It typically consists of a pair of prisms with the same refractive index but with relative deflection, and is widely used in laser systems, interferometers, and optical alignment to achieve precise adjustment and superposition of optical paths.
